WebFIRST & LAST / ODD & EVEN LETTERS CLUE: The first or last letter of the words of the clue can be joined together to form a solution, or just a part of it. The indicators for solutions formed using the initials or the last letter could be initially, originally, in the beginning, starting, at the outset, finally, ending, lastly , etc. 14 WebPins: superfluous without an end (7) Power plant lacks a spiritual leader (6) The answer to the first clue, needles , is needless (“superfluous”) without its final letter. In the second clue, reactor (“power plant”) lacks a; this gives the answer, rector (“spiritual leader”). 7.

WebDec 2, 2016 · Cryptic clues are followed by a number or numbers in parentheses indicating the length of the answer: (5) means it’s a five-letter word, while (2,3,4) indicates a three-word phrase like “in the know.” Here are the eight common methods by which hints are given via wordplay, and hints for spotting them: Printable pdfs Cryptic Crosswords …
WebNov 24, 2016 · Abbreviations are commonly used in cryptic clues to clue 1-3 letters. There are many different cryptic abbreviations - here are just a few: Roman numerals; Chemical element symbols; Country codes; Phonetic alphabets ("Bravo" → B) Chess notation; …
